Sri Lanka’s 121 was a below-par total given dew was only going to increase as temperatures reduced
Rodrigues fifty leads India’s chase after bowlers set up victory against Sri Lanka
Other News
- Chinese player banned over match-fixing spree
- Jayhawks asst. Dooley suspended after DUI arrest
- F1, FIA agree new Concorde Agreement to 2030
- Super-rare Ohtani MVP card sells for record $3M
- Japan HR record-setter Murakami picks ChiSox
- Suzie Bates ruled out for three months with quadricep injury